My answer to your question is: As I was told when I decided to get interested in vintage tube audio a few years back (ahem). "There are thousands of them out there, parts are easy and cheap, you can get the assembly instructions and put it togeather yourself (again), advice is plentiful and there are many upgrades/mods to do when your ready."
It really does sound good especially after a fresh rebuild. It's a good way to get aquainted with tubes. It will drive most decent speakers until you can decide which way you want to go in drivers, so there is no immediacy in doing drastic upgrades. Most of all it was fun to learn on.
